GigaSpaces Patterns and Topologies

What is this event?

  • A 90 minute presentation covering the common usage patterns for the XAP platform plus a focused discussion on the clustering options available

Why should I attend?

You should attend if your GigaSpaces application effort requires understanding of the possibilities offered by the XAP platform.
This session covers:

  • The common types of services customers implement and their relationship to the system as a whole
  • The service-grid infrastructure and behavior
  • The space modes offered –specifically: Embedded, Remote, Master-Local, View
  • The cluster modes offered: Replicated, Partitioned

Improving Business Services with GigaSpaces Service Virtualization (Remoting)

What is this event?
A walk-through and demonstration of:

  • How GigaSpaces Remoting differs from standard solutions
  • The difference between Synchronous and Asynchronous Remoting
  • How to implement Scatter-Gather / Map-Reduce patterns using Synchronous Remoting
  • How to use Asynchronous Remoting with a java.util.concurrent.Future to execute long-running calculations without blocking

Why should I attend?

  • The Service Virtualization Framework allows complete decoupling between your client code and the GigaSpaces Runtime
  • Learn to define and implement business interfaces and clients that do *not* need to know there is a space involved
  • Services implemented using GigaSpaces Remoting achieve linear scalability and nuke-proof reliability
